How to create a Stored Procedure in MySQL?

How to create a Stored Procedure in MySQL?

A stored procedure is a group of SQL statements that we save in the database. The SQL queries, including INSERT, UPDATE, DELETE, etc. can be a part of the stored procedure. A procedure allows us to use the same code over and over again by executing a single statement. It stores in the database data dictionary.

We can create a stored procedure using the below syntax:

CREATE PROCEDURE procedure_name [ (parameter datatype [, parameter datatype]) ]
Body_section of SQL statements
This statement can return one or more value through parameters or may not return any result. The following example explains it more clearly:

CREATE PROCEDURE get_student_info()
SELECT * FROM Student_table;